DESCRIPTION:Join the Temecula Valley Chamber of Commerce as we celebrate 25 years of Michelle’s Place Cancer Resource Center with a special Ribbon Cutting Ceremony! \nFor the past 25 years\, Michelle’s Place has been dedicated to ensuring that no one faces cancer alone. What began as a vision to support those impacted by cancer has grown into a full-service cancer resource center providing compassionate\, no-cost services to individuals and families affected by all types of cancer. \nTheir mission is to provide comprehensive support through a wide range of programs and resources\, including behavioral health counseling for individuals and families\, support groups\, art programs\, wellness classes\, one-on-one peer support\, educational workshops\, wig fittings and wigs\, prostheses\, and many other services designed to help patients and their loved ones navigate the cancer journey. \nThe Ribbon Cutting Ceremony will take place at 4:30 p.m. on Wednesday\, August 19\, 2026\, just before the evening Chamber Mixer. DESCRIPTION:Tuesdays — In Person only \nTai chi helps reduce stress and anxiety. And it also helps increase flexibility and balance. Originally developed for self-defense\, tai chi has evolved into a graceful form of exercise that’s now used for stress reduction and a variety of other health conditions.
